What Stands Out

Low PIM Design
Engineered for low passive intermodulation, ensuring clear signal quality and minimizing interference in critical applications.
High Power Rating
Supports up to 500W power capacity, making it ideal for high-performance broadcasting and communication systems.
Wide Frequency Range
Operates effectively across 137-960MHz, providing versatility for various RF applications and ensuring compatibility with multiple devices.

  • Question: How does the 6.0 dB attenuation affect signal strength?

    Answer: The 6.0 dB attenuation provided by the MicroLab DN-51FN tapper reduces the signal strength by this amount, which can be beneficial in preventing overload in downstream devices. This attenuation allows for better control of signal levels, optimizing performance, especially in environments with multiple signal sources or weak signal conditions.
